1. A method of treating an acid-base disorder of a human patient, the method comprising:
determining at least one treatment recommendation for the acid-base disorder for a population of virtual patients using an acid-base model configured to model the acid-base disorder via modelling serum pH regulation of a human bicarbonate (HCO2)/carbon dioxide (CO2) buffering system using human renal and pulmonary regulatory mechanisms to generate predicted patient information, the predicted patient information comprising a serum pH level determined by the acid-base model based on a HCO2 concentration and a CO2 concentration, wherein:
the HCO2 concentration is determined based, at least in part, on a renal filtration rate of HCO2 model parameter, and
the CO2 concentration is determined based, at least in part, on a removal of CO2 through respiratory ventilation model parameter,
accessing the at least one treatment recommendation determined via the acid-base model;
diagnosing that the patient has the acid-base disorder; and
administering a treatment to the patient determined to correspond with the at least one treatment recommendation to treat the acid-base disorder, wherein the acid-base disorder is metabolic acidosis and the patient is treated with at least one of HCO2 therapy or acid-binder therapy.
